Industry Pain Points

The machinery manufacturing industry covers vehicle assembly plants, heavy machinery, precision machining, molds, and welding assembly. The gas risk characteristics are a combination of "process dust + VOC spraying + localized open flames": ① **Welding workshop**: argon arc/CO2 welding fumes (including NOx + CO + manganese + chromium, etc.), with employees densely exposed for long periods, causing respiratory damage; ② **Spraying/coating line**: VOCs (toluene/xylene/butyl acetate) + curing oven LEL. In recent years, a certain automobile OEM has invested tens of millions of yuan in VOC rectification in its spraying workshop; ③ **Casting workshop**: high-temperature CO + SO2 (coke combustion) + dust (metal dust has an explosion lower limit); ④ **Heat treatment workshop**: carburizing/nitriding/quenching — CO (protective gas) + NH3 (nitriding) + CH4 (carrier gas); ⑤ **Machining cutting fluid**: long-term use of water-based cutting fluid produces bacteria → endotoxin + odor; ⑥ **Environmental regulation**: HJ 1093 emission standards + LDAR legal requirements + boundary odor control + park supervision. The machinery manufacturing industry is the second largest source of VOC emissions (accounting for 12% of the national total), and is subject to strict regulation.

## Key Monitoring Nodes (By Process)

### Welding Workshop
– CO 0-200 ppm + NOx(NO + NO2)
– PM2.5 + PM10 (welding fume)
– Distributed probes: 1 probe per welding position + linkage with the air volume of a mobile welding fume extractor

### Spraying / Coating Line
– **Spray Booth**: VOC PID 0-1000 ppm (toluene / xylene / butyl acetate) + LEL
– **Leveling / Drying**: VOC + Temperature
– **Curing oven**: LEL × 25% high alarm → shut off main gas valve; CO incomplete combustion + O2 combustion monitoring
– **RTO regenerative thermal oxidizer**: inlet + outlet VOC concentration (calculated treatment efficiency = 100% × (inlet – outlet) / inlet, ≥ 95% compliance)
– **Workshop main exhaust outlet**: Continuous Emission Monitoring System (CEMS) for flue gas (VOC + particulate matter + NOx + SO2)

### Foundry workshop
– Cupola / Furnace: CO + SO2 (coke combustion)
– Pouring / Sand Removal: Dust (explosive metal dust → explosion-proof grade Ex d IIIB / IIIC) + CO
– Sand processing: dust + VOC (resin sand)

### Heat treatment workshop
– Carburizing / Nitriding / Quenching Furnaces: Multi-component detection of CO, NH3, and CH4
– Furnace door interlock: CO + LEL detection must meet the standard before opening the door
– Atmosphere furnace: H2 + CO + N2 flow rate + concentration monitoring

### Machining / Assembly (Low Risk)
– Cutting fluid mist + endotoxin
– Local VOC (cleaning agent usage)

## Key Technical Specifications

– Explosion-proof: Ex d IIB T4 (spray coating / baking oven) + Ex d IIIC (cast metal dust)
– Protection: IP65 (high dust in workshop + cutting fluid splash)
– Range: VOC PID 0-1000 ppm (PPB level sensitivity) + LEL 0-100%
– Response time: T90 < 30 seconds (PID)
– Operating temperature: -20℃ ~ +60℃ (workshop) + 80℃ (high temperature casting)
– Communication: Modbus + Profinet (interface with workshop PLC / SCADA)
– CEMS flue gas online monitoring: certified by CCEP / CMC (issued by the Ministry of Environmental Protection)

## Implementation Key

1. **VOC + RTO treatment efficiency compliance**: The core of strict environmental management requires monitoring of both inlet and outlet concentrations to demonstrate a treatment efficiency of ≥ 95% (GB 16297 + HJ 733)
2. **LDAR statutory leak detection**: Conduct PID inspections on flange, valve, and pump sealing points four times a year. Any reading exceeding 500 ppm indicates a leak
3. **Integrated welding fume purification**: Increase in CO + NOx → Automatically increase the air volume of the welding fume purifier
4. **Casting dust explosion protection**: The lower explosion limit of metal dust accumulation is much lower than that of gas (aluminum powder 30g/m³), requiring independent explosion-proof IIIC level + anti-static grounding
5. **Data-linked environmental monitoring platform**: CEMS data is automatically reported to the local environmental protection bureau every minute, and in case of exceeding standards, an automatic SMS notification will be sent to the factory manager + a warning of potential fines

## Regulatory Basis

– HJ 1093-2020 "Continuous Monitoring System for Pollution Source Flue Gas"
– HJ 733-2014 "Control of Volatile Organic Compound (VOC) Emissions from Leaks and Open Liquid Surfaces"
– HJ 1131-2020 "Technical Guidelines for Leak Detection and Repair (LDAR) of Volatile Organic Compounds in Industrial Enterprises"
– GB 16297-1996 Integrated Emission Standard of Air Pollutants
– GB 50058 Electrical Apparatus for Explosive Gas Atmospheres
– GB 50493 Detection and Alarm Design
– GBZ 2.1 Limits (Welding Fume / Cutting Fluid Mist PC-TWA)
